The aim is to sneak into the Linux marketplace, as Richard Gooding, Product Manager at PROIV, admits: “The Linux world tends to expect free software, so we thought a penguin campaign might hit the mark. Feedback has been hilarious – I sometimes wonder if there’s more interest in a squishy penguin than Linux development software.”
PROIV hopes that developers will start to use the Single Developer version – which is not time-limited and delivers fully working applications – and then move on to the enterprise runtime licence, which is chargeable.
What the story is *really* about
PROIV is one of the leading RAD tools, and this is the first Linux version. The aim is to get PROIV into Linux developers’ hands, so they learn and understand the environment.
PROIV Single Developer is free, and fully functional. There is one component that is not included: the full multi-user runtime. If a developer writes an application that needs a full runtime licence (for multiple use or for multiple developers), then that becomes chargeable.
This model is the opposite of many development tools. Rather than pay up front for a development environment, with PROIV Single Developer you can create and run as many single applications as you like, and never pay a penny until you “go commercial.”
When the applications go into full-scale commercial production, then a licence fee becomes payable, and a full copy of the PROIV software is required (which has some additional functionality suitable to enterprise-scale operations).
This free-until-you-make-money approach is much closer to the Linux model, and is intended to help PROIV gain acceptance in the Linux world.
Northgate Information Solutions and PROIV
Northgate’s PROIV is a RAD technology used by software developers to build all aspects of business applications for organisations working in a wide range of sectors including finance, manufacturing, retail, government, construction, transportation and leisure.
